<p>The potential departure of Canelo Alvarez from Premier Boxing Champions (PBC) and a potential return to DAZN has sparked significant speculation and discussion within the boxing community. Here&#8217;s a breakdown of the situation:</p>
<ol>
<li><strong>Background</strong>: Canelo Alvarez, the undisputed super middleweight champion, has been with Premier Boxing Champions (PBC) for a period, but recent disagreements over opponent selection for his next fight have strained the relationship.</li>
<li><strong>Opponent Dispute</strong>: Canelo has reportedly been pushing for a bout with WBC middleweight champion Jermall Charlo, but PBC seems hesitant due to concerns over the fight&#8217;s market value. There are rumors that PBC is reluctant to pay Canelo his $35 million guarantee for this matchup.</li>
<li><strong>Alternative Options</strong>: In response, PBC has proposed alternative opponents, including Jaime Munguia, who is represented by Golden Boy Promotions. PBC&#8217;s recent partnership with Amazon Prime adds complexity to the situation, as they aim to make a big impact with their top fighters.</li>
<li><strong>Canelo&#8217;s Patience</strong>: Canelo appears to be growing impatient with the situation and is exploring other options for his next fight. There are indications that he may not be satisfied with the proposed opponents or the direction PBC is taking.</li>
<li><strong>Potential Move</strong>: While there&#8217;s speculation about Canelo&#8217;s departure from PBC, no official announcement has been made. Contractual obligations and stipulations will likely play a significant role in any decision to switch broadcasters.</li>
<li><strong>Past Experience</strong>: Canelo has previously switched from DAZN to PBC for a single fight against Caleb Plant in 2021. If there&#8217;s a similar clause in his contract, he could explore this option again.</li>
<li><strong>Potential Return to DAZN/Matchroom</strong>: If Canelo decides to leave PBC, DAZN and Matchroom would likely welcome him back with open arms. There&#8217;s a history of successful collaboration between Canelo and DAZN, with several high-profile fights streamed under their banner.</li>
</ol>
<p>In summary, while the situation regarding Canelo&#8217;s potential departure from PBC and return to DAZN is still uncertain, it&#8217;s clear that significant negotiations and discussions are underway, with various factors at play, including contractual obligations, financial considerations, and future career prospects.</p>
